Sumario: | The search for a light charged Higgs boson at the LHC will greatly depend on how well the QCD background can be controlled, especially for the fully hadronic final state where it is expected that QCD is overwhelmingly the dominant source of background. As the QCD production cross section at the LHC is large and more importantly poorly known, specific methods to suppress and consequently predict the remaining QCD multi-jet background are required. Several methods of suppressing this QCD background and data-driven methods to estimate the remaining in the
signal region are discussed for both the lepton+jets and fully hadronic final state signal channels. |
